drawing of a cocktail shaker drawing of a cocktail glassFault Creep

Shake with ice:

1 oz Cocchi Americano Bianco

1 oz Fernet Branca

1 oz pineapple Juice

1 bar spoon lemon juice

3 dash Angostura Bitters

Double-strain into a coupe.

Garnish with a pineapple leaf.

Kellie Thorn, Empire State South, Atlanta, Georgia


Cocchi Americano Bianco

ItalyPiemonte 16.5% ABV

16.5% ABV

Made to the same recipe since 1891, this Moscato-based aperitif wine has long been a staple of Asti. While the Americano name implies a gentian focus, the wine also includes quinine and citrus for a flavorful, refreshing profile. In Piemonte it is served chilled with ice, a splash of soda and a peel of orange. Cocchi Americano Bianco’s combination of fruit, spice and bitter undertones can perfect a number of classic mixed drinks. This same profile makes it splendid pairing with all kinds of pickles, nuts, charcuterie and cheeses.
